NORTHEAST WRESTLING STUDIO WARS EPISODE THREE REPORT

By Adam Cardoza on 2020-11-24 23:03:00

Northeast Wrestling "NEW Studio Wars: Episode 3"
Taped in Rhode Island.
Available Now at www.HighspotsWrestlingNetwork.com


PREVIOUSLY ON NEW STUDIO WARS: 

This is episode three of Northeast Wrestling's STUDIO WARS - A new weekly wrestling program that can be found on the Highspots Wrestling Network. Paul Crockett, Jon Roy & Matt Taven are your commentary team.

Match 1: Love, Doug vs Thrillride

Last week, Doug slapped Thrillride in the face at the commentary table after his win over Moshpit. Thrillride is "tanned like a burnt hot dog", says an excited Jon Roy. Doug blows Thrillride a kiss as an apology for last week. Thrillride puts it in his pocket. Doug throws a handful of flower petals into Thrillride's face, which....really does nothing and he eats a clothesline at the bell. Doug gets chopped and whipped around the ring. Thillride goes to work on the lower extremities of Love, Doug with a trip to the post, a couple of atomic drops and a headbutt. Doug catches Thrillride on the top rope and hits a cross body from the top. Whiff on a big splash and Thrillride with lariats and a neckbreaker. Big powerslam leads to a sitout spinebuster and that's it for Loverboy.

Winner: Thrillride

Love, Doug definitely bit off more than he should have, as Thrillride just took him to the woodshed. Just enough goofing here to raise Thrillride's ire and the rest was a big ol' squash.

Match 2: "The Natural" Channing Thomas vs "The American Sumo" Mike Gamble

Both these guys are coming off of losses on episode 1. Thomas fell to Waves & Curls' Traevon Jordan. Gamble was in that killer main event with Wrecking Ball Legursky. A fearful Thomas is trying to slip away from the grasp of the VERY aggressive American Sumo. He gets a slap in on the big man before getting the taste smacked out of his mouth, a german-style urange and big splash for two. Two avalanche splashes hit but Thomas dodges the third and Gamble posts himself. The Natural working over the arm and shoulder and hitting a series of european uppercuts. Thomas gets too confident in the corner and posts himself as well. Gamble whipping Thomas from corner to corner. Big headbutt, running corner hit attack, belly to beelly suplex from the Sumo. Gamble takes too long taunting a Banzai drop, Thomas rolls out, goes for a crossbdy but Gamble catches him. Big Samoan Drop. 1, 2, 3.

Winner: Mike Gamble

Solid contest. I love the aggression the American Sumo has displayed in his two outings on Studio Wars. Channing Thomas tried to play keepaway and but he got caught.

Match 5: Gio Galvano vs Wrecking Ball Legursky

Galvano is making his NEW debut and, while he did get an on-camera entrance, I worry for his chances here. Legursky slams him to the mat right off the tie up. Galvano back up and throws a couple of leg kicks to throw the big man off. Doesn't last, Wrecking Ball with a gorilla press. Gio slips a second one and goes back to the leg. Galvano creates distance and that was a mistake. Big shoulder block from Wrecking Ball and he goes to work with chops and drops. Gio dodges a sitout senton and hits a STIFF penalty kick. More stomps and kicks and he finally takes Legursky down. Springboard legdrop but only a one count. A kick to the face wakes up the Wrecking Ball, avalanche splash and a pair of tosses. Legursky with a huge lariat but Gio kicks out! Wrecking Ball to the second rope, misses a splash. Gio with a headbutt and pele kick! Running forearms! Bulldog off the top! Two count! Gio misses a boot, Wrecking Ball with a one-arm slam and it's over!

Winner: Wrecking Ball Legursky

THIS WAS GOOD SH*T. I don't think anyone expected what we saw from Gio Galvano tonight. He may have been way overpowered against the Wrecking Ball but he clearly brought a PLAN to the fight and it almost worked out for him. I expect to see more of Galvano in the weeks to come but damn, Wrecking Ball was in another show stealer. :)
